Ekneligoda Case: “Military Suspects” To Be Taken To Giritale Army Camp For Further Grilling

Suspects, who are currently in custody over Prageeth Ekneligoda‘s disappearance are to be taken to the Giritale Army camp by the CID to conduct further probes.

Earlier the courts granted permission for CID investigators to visit the Giritale camp where Ekneligoda is said to have been detained soon after his arrest.

The CID investigators are to visit Girithale camp under the protection of Military police.

A team from the CID along with the suspects are to visit the Giritale camp during the next few days.

The CID has so far taken into custody 10 suspects including two lieutenant colonels in connection with the disappearance of Ekneligoda.

The suspects arrested in this connection had previously worked with the military intelligence, according to sources.

The CID investigators are to peruse documents and probe other evidence related to the case during their visit to the Giritale camp.
